解释字典、函数、条件语句、循环语句。
时间: 2023-08-17 21:06:19 浏览: 40
当我们编写程序时,字典、函数、条件语句和循环语句是非常常见的概念和结构。下面是这些概念的简要解释:
1. 字典:字典是Python中的一种数据结构,用于存储键值对。每个键对应一个值,可以通过键来快速查找对应的值。字典是可变的,可以动态地添加、修改或删除键值对。
2. 函数:函数是一种可重复使用的代码块,用于执行特定的任务。函数可以接受参数,也可以返回值,使程序更加灵活和可读性更高。Python中的函数可以自定义,也可以是内置函数。
3. 条件语句:条件语句用于根据某些条件来执行不同的代码块。在Python中,条件语句通常使用if、elif和else关键字来实现。当条件满足时,执行相应的代码块。
4. 循环语句:循环语句用于重复执行某段代码块,直到满足某些条件为止。在Python中,循环语句通常使用for和while关键字来实现。for循环用于遍历一个可迭代对象,而while循环则需要满足某个条件才会执行。
相关问题
python中for循环语句
Python中的for循环语句是一种迭代控制流语句,可以用于遍历序列(如字符串、列表、元组、字典、集合)中的每个元素,或者执行指定次数的循环。for循环语句的语法结构如下:
```
for 变量 in 序列:
# 循环体代码块
```
其中,变量是在循环过程中用来存储序列中每个元素的变量名,序列可以是任何可迭代对象,如字符串、列表、元组、字典、集合等。在循环体代码块中,可以对变量进行操作,完成相应的任务。
除了for循环语句,Python中还有while循环语句。与for必须指定循环多少次不一样的是,while循环的次数可以是不定的,只要条件满足就可以永远循环下去。可以使用Python内置函数range()来在for循环中控制循环次数。range()函数的作用是产生一个由数字组成的序列。
pythonfor循环语句
Python中的for循环语句可以用来遍历任何可迭代对象,如列表、元组、字符串、字典等。for循环语句的基本语法如下:
```python
for 变量 in 可迭代对象:
执行语句块
```
其中,变量为每次循环中从可迭代对象中取出的值,可迭代对象可以是列表、元组、字符串、字典等。执行语句块中可以包含任何Python语句,包括条件语句、函数调用等。
例如,下面的代码演示了如何使用for循环语句遍历一个列表:
```python
fruits = ["apple", "banana", "cherry"]
for fruit in fruits:
print(fruit)
```
运行结果为:
```
apple
banana
cherry
```
在这个例子中,将变量fruit依次赋值为列表fruits中的每一个元素,并且将其打印出来。